CANADIAN WILDFIRE SMOKE SPREADS HAZARDOUS AIR QUALITY ACROSS THE U.S.

Before-and-after photos show just how quickly wildfire smoke has swallowed city skylines across parts of the U.S.

A persistent northwesterly wind is carrying smoke from nearly 80 out-of-control wildfires in Ontario, Canada, blanketing parts of the Northeast and Midwest in thick haze and unhealthy air.

Forecasters say the smoky conditions could stick around into Saturday before winds shift and help improve air quality.
